# Contacts: BigDiff (Large-File Diff Viewer)

BigDiff owns rendering diffs over 50 MB. Chunked rendering, syntax highlighting, and the binary-file summarizer are all theirs. Perf regressions: file under the bigdiff-perf label, not general UI. Crashes on files over 2 GB: known issue, fix targeted next sprint — don't re-report. Feature requests go through the Tollbridge intake form, reviewed Thursdays. For anything blocking this week's release, skip the form and email the team directly.

billing contact of tahaf-kafop = istwyn_fraox@norvaworks.corp

Several merchants on the Pennywheel platform report totals off by one minor unit when converting between currencies with differing decimal precision. The converter rounds at each intermediate step instead of once at the end, so chained conversions accumulate drift. Support should flag affected invoices rather than manually adjusting them; finance will reissue corrected statements. A fix landed in the Tillgrove branch and is staged for verification. The candidate build is identified below.

trace token, fafog-kageg: htk4_98e6

Handover: formula sandbox (Calcwright). User formulas run in the Fenner isolate pool; CPU cap 200ms, no network. Escapes page on-call automatically. Known gap: recursive imports bypass the depth check — fix pending in branch `sandbox-depth`. To restart the isolate pool you must unseal the runner vault first. Unsealing prompts for the recovery passphrase, given here:

vault phrase of bagaf-kajeg = jorath-feniel-briir-siliel-ralix

Handing over Graphwright, our dependency graph visualizer, to Petra for the security pass. Rendering is client-side; the parser ingests untrusted manifest files, so focus review there — we sanitize node labels but edge tooltips were added recently and may not be covered. Threat model notes and prior findings are collected on the internal page below.

dashboard of tawef-hagug = https://superset.norvadyn.local/display/projects/build/ticket/build/spaces/ticket/1e989f0e6c200d20fc4ae06b